Unwanted trailing slash on remote repo source url (not a valid source url)

I have a GitHub repo that I'm trying to clone, and keep getting an error that the source URL is not valid. Looking at the error, Sourcetree is adding a trailing slash to the URL for some reason. How do I ask it to not? Thanks.

Similar issue in Fork client here suggest removing and adding again Github credentials https://github.com/fork-dev/Tracker/issues/211 This may be a git problem with bad error messaging, not sourcetree
